The Polytechnic University of the Philippines (PUP) and the Civil Service Commission (CSC) jointly launched on April 10 the ‘Contact Center ng Bayan’ or CCB, a government assistance center which is now housed at the PUP BPO Center along Pureza Street in Sta. Mesa, Manila.
CSC Chairperson Dr. Francisco T. Duque III graced the occasion along with other officials who received warm welcome from University executives led by PUP President Dr. Emanuel C. De Guzman.
Dr. Duque congratulated and thanked PUP for hosting the CCB. He said that the center will be a great help in promoting professionalism, outstanding service and better governance. The center will cater to inquiries and complaints from Filipino citizens and clients of different government agencies and offices.
PUP President De Guzman, meanwhile, declared that PUP is very proud of the launching after months of concerted efforts and numerous consultations. He said that among those who would be very happy is Commission on Higher on Education (CHED) and former PUP Board of Regents (BOR) Chairperson Dr. Patricia B. Licuanan who insisted that the PUP BPO Center should be revived to generate income for the University and at the same time provide service to the country.
PUP Vice President for Administration Prof. Alberto C. Guillo gave the welcome remarks while CSC Public Assistance Information Office Director Dr. Maria Luisa S. Agamata, provided information on the CCB Project. CCB Project Director Marlon Lim delivered the closing remarks.
